Kala Chana Chaat

Kala Chana Chaat

Kala Chana Chaat is spicy, tangy, delicious, and popular Indian Street food! It is perfect as an evening Time snack. This very popular chaat recipe is perfect for a Ramadan iftar table! a made of boiled chickpea, potatoes, spices, and herbs. Here for the step-by-step detailed recipe of chaat. You can try my other chaat Recipe HereChana Chaat (White Chickpea chaat)
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Soaked Time 10 hours
Course Snack
Cuisine Indian, Pakistan
Servings 4 People

Ingredients
  

  • 2 Cups Black Chickpeas Good quality
  • 4 Medium-sized Potatoes Cut into cubes
  • 2 Medium-sized Tomatoes Chopped
  • 2 Medium-sized Onions Chopped
  • 2 Green chili chopped is optional
  • Coriander leaves as needed
  • 5 Tbsp Lemon Juice
  • 2 Tbsp Coriander Powder
  • 1/2 Tbsp Cumin Powder
  • 2 Tbsp Red chili powder
  • 2 Tbsp Red chili flakes
  • 1/2 Tsp Chaat Masala
  • 1/2 Tbsp Salt
  • 1/4 Cup Oil

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Rinse and soak chickpeas in enough water for 8-10 hours or overnight. Drain out the excess water and rinse them again with fresh running water in the morning and set aside. Add rinsed chickpeas to a pressure cooker along with salt, water, Pressure cook chickpeas for 4-5 whistles on low heat. Let the pressure come off completely before opening the lid.
  • Rinse the potatoes in water then boil 4 medium-sized potatoes in a pot with water.
  • Peel and chop the potatoes into cubes. Chop 2 medium-sized tomatoes and 1 medium-sized onion and chop a few coriander leaves and finely chop 2 green chilies.

Cook

  • Heat 1/4 cup oil in a pot. Now add chop onion and sauté it for 2-3 minutes on medium heat. Once the onion is slightly translucent. Now add boiled chickpeas(chole) and fry for 2 minutes on medium heat.
  • Add boiled potato and fry for 1 minute.
  • Now add homemade chana chaat masala and lemon juice and mix gently.
  • Add chopped tomatoes and fry for 1 minute until tomatoes are slightly softened.
  • Finally, add chopped coriander leaves and chopped green chili.
